My heart ached for Grace and burned for Boone and his boneheaded behavior that lead to their painful breakup. I got that he had his reasons and was a young man dealing with a lot of heavy issues, but still pretty steamed at the way he chose to avoid being honest with Grace. Lost a bit of respect for him there.
I did like the way he finally manned up after he moved back even though he waited a year before trying to mend his bridges.
Grace understandably had trust issues with men. It was kind of sad that she came off a bit petty when it came to her restart relationship with Boone. Not saying I blame her at all. I was team Grace all the way, and my heart hurt with what she had to deal with. I thought she was really forgiving once she found out the truth, and I still thought Boone got off really easy for pretty much lying and ghosting "for her own good" ugh.
Wasn't too fond of Boone when his ex showed up out of the blue and allowing her some private time with her while Grace was left hanging. I felt bad for Grace, Again.
The bit of health drama involving Grace and Boone kind of cemented their commitment to each other, and I liked the way the author pulled them together at the end.
